Transaction f8e367dd5c17a22433e6e9af4e18d28c3dc2df709ff58de857a181d9a46a582d

21 Input
1 Outputs
  • f8e367dd5c17a22433e6e9af4e18d28c3dc2df709ff58de857a181d9a46a582d:0
  • value  10458580
    address  3D8UNx7pRn8dccrg55dvhtxACswe55sFBH